Registering Your Vehicle Online in Henderson County: Documents, the 90‑Day Inspection Rule, and Trailer Limits
Henderson County lets you register your car or trailer online, but two things catch people off guard: your inspection must be recent, and some trailers can't go through the online system at all. Here's how to get it done right the first time.
Yes - the Henderson County Tax Office allows you to register your automobile or trailer online, and you can pay by credit card through the county’s registration page.
Before you start, check your inspection date. Henderson County requires your automobile to have been inspected within the past 90 days prior to registration. Fall outside that window? The online system won't work. Save yourself the headache and verify the date first.
- ✓ Find the inspection date and confirm it’s within the past 90 days.
- ✓ Count the 90-day window from the inspection date (not the day you start the online form).
- ✓ Check your inspection timing before you begin the online registration so you don’t have to stop mid-process.
Not every trailer qualifies for online registration. Henderson County's Tax Office says trailers without a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) cannot be registered online. No VIN on your trailer? You'll need to handle it through a different process.
Note: Look for a VIN on your trailer before starting online registration. If there isn't one, skip the website and plan for an in-person or alternate route.
If you meet the requirements, the process is simple. Head to the Henderson County Tax Office's online registration page (look for the "register online with a credit card" option). Before entering any details, confirm your inspection is within the 90-day window - the county requires your automobile inspection to be within the past 90 days prior to registration.
- ✓ A credit card for the online payment (Henderson County’s online registration option is set up for credit card use).
- ✓ Your vehicle inspection information, with an inspection date within the past 90 days (required before registration).
- ✓ The vehicle/trailer details you’ll be prompted to enter on the county’s online registration page (have your identifying information handy so you can type it in accurately).
- Open the Henderson County online registration page - use the county’s option to register your automobile or trailer online with a credit card.
- Enter your vehicle or trailer details - type in the identifying information the form requests.
- Confirm you’re eligible to proceed - make sure nothing in your situation blocks online registration.
- Pay by credit card and submit - complete checkout through the county’s online system.
Inspection older than 90 days? Get a new one first, then come back to register. Henderson County's rule is firm: your automobile must have been inspected within the past 90 days prior to registration.
